A Comprehensive Look at Gold IRAs: Advantages and Disadvantages
Considering a bullion IRA as part of your retirement planning? It's a popular choice, offering potential pros like asset diversification. However, there are also risks to be aware of before making this investment.
- Pros can include potential for growth during inflationary periods, and diversification by including an asset class distinct from traditional stocks and bonds. Additionally, gold holdings are often perceived as a stable asset in times of market uncertainty.
- Drawbacks to consider include fluctuating prices, as the value of gold can be unpredictable. Additionally, expenses associated with setting up and maintaining a precious metals IRA can impact overall gains.
It's crucial to weigh the factors of both pros and cons before deciding if a gold IRA is right for you. Consulting with a retirement planner can provide tailored advice based on your individual circumstances.

Unlocking Tax Advantages with a Gold IRA: A Comprehensive Guide
Considering the shifting economic environment, numerous individuals are exploring alternative investment strategies to protect their wealth. Among these, Gold IRAs have emerged as beneficial option due to their potential tax advantages. This in-depth guide will examine the principles behind Gold IRAs and how they can assist you in leveraging your tax position.
- Understanding the Principles of a Gold IRA: A Gold IRA is a type of Individual Retirement Account (IRA) that allows you to invest physical gold, along with other precious metals, as part of your retirement savings.
- Tax-Deferred Growth: Gold IRAs offer favorable tax treatment, meaning that any gains earned within the account are not subject to taxation until retirement.
- Asset Diversification: Gold has historically been viewed as a safe haven asset, which can help maintain the worth of your retirement savings during periods of economic turmoil.
Contributing to a Gold IRA: To open a Gold IRA, you will require partner with a reputable financial institution that provides precious metal IRAs. The procedure typically involve choosing an account type, contributing your funds, and then selecting the desired gold holdings.
